-   -   --destination-ports port[,port[,port...]] (

KevinGuy 03-16-2004 12:46 PM

--destination-ports port[,port[,port...]]
Why is it that I get this:

iptables v1.2.7a: Unknown arg `--destination-ports'
Try `iptables -h' or 'iptables --help' for more information.

when I have this code:

$IPT -I TRAFFIC -p tcp --destination-ports 5631,5633,5635 -s -j ACCEPT
It wont let me use multiple ports.... i have to use either --dport, or --destination-port. But this only alows me to use one single port.


chort 03-16-2004 07:06 PM

Well according to the iptables man page it says the multiport module will allow you to use --destination-port port[,port], etc. So it looks like it shouldn't be plural (port, not ports) and you also need the multiport module for netfilter.

You could also write it in a for loop, if you wanted

for port in 5631 5633 5635 ; do $IPT -I TRAFFIC -p tcp --dport $port -s -j ACCEPT ; done ; unset port

